titleOfInvention | Implant for the human body |
abstract | At least the outer tube (1) of an implant consisting of a plurality of tubes (1), which serves as a ligament replacement, is provided with a closed, abrasion-impermeable layer of an elastomer (3), the layer thickness of which is between the threads (2) and am Edge does not exceed 0.1 mm.n n n In this way, abrasion is prevented from escaping into the surrounding body tissue without the mechanical behavior, such as extensibility, bending stiffness and / or torsional stability, being adversely changed compared to an implant without an elastomer layer. |
